Since 1989, Reedpoint has been staging the <a href="http://visitmt.com/categories/moreinfo.asp?IDRRecordID=8886&SiteID=1">Running of the Sheep</a> on Labor Day Weekend. I have never personally been to it but I have been told it is a fun event to attend. I now see that Te Kuiti, a town in New Zealand, has picked up on this and has enacted its own <a href="http://www.theage.com.au/articles/2004/04/03/1080941724083.html">Running of the Sheep</a>.
